Deuteronomy 11:15
And I will send grass in thy fields for thy cattle, that thou mayest eat and be full.
Context
This verse from Deuteronomy Chapter 11 connects to 10 cross-references. Moses urges Israel to love God and keep all his commands, recalling the great acts they witnessed in Egypt and the wilderness.
